Anybody remember the old Can Am Bowl? It was an all star game played in Tampa from '77- '79. It featured a mixture of American and Canadian rules.

Mike, tell us more about the Canadian Schools that have petitioned the NCAA.


333 posted on 12/29/2006 4:41:13 PM PST by SoCal Pubbie
[ Post Reply | Private Reply | To 24 | View Replies]

To: SoCal Pubbie

The College Football Data Warehouse website lists only two Can Am Bowl games, in '78 and '79. In both games the US all stars beat the Canadian all stars, first 22-7 and then 34-14.
